The Silencers from 1966 is a gripping and exciting blend of comedy and spy thriller genres. Directed by Phil Karlson, it stars Dean Martin, Stella Stevens, and Daliah Lavi. In keeping with the era's fascination with James Bond-like stories, it introduces an intriguing mix of mystery, danger, wit, and charisma. The film has been widely celebrated for its unique take on the spy genre and its comic perspective.
The Silencers features Dean Martin as the protagonist, Matt Helm. Helm is an effectively retired spy who is reeled back into the world of espionage and danger not for the thrills or the glory, but rather dragged back in as a duty to his livelihood and given no other choice. Martin, carrying his singular charm and smooth disposition, adds an element of fun, making the character loveably reluctant yet relentlessly efficient. His punchy one-liners, humorous reactions, and stylish mannerisms provide a comedic relief that ingeniously complements the movie’s tension-filled scenes.
Opposite Martin, Stella Stevens stars as Gail Hendricks, a bubbly, somewhat naive yet enterprising woman who accidentally finds herself entangled in the intricate world of international espionage. She portrays the role exquisitely, exhibiting both vulnerability and intelligence as the character's development intersects with Helm's mission progress. Her on-screen chemistry with Martin also adds to the humor and excitement conveyed throughout the movie.
Daliah Lavi plays the role of the treacherously seductive, yet lethal, Tina, an enemy spy with her own secretive agenda. Her performance adds an element of danger and suspense, serving as an enigmatic, magnetic force constantly endeavoring to outwit and outmaneuver Helm. This relationship is quintessential to the classic spy film aura – the tempting femme fatale versus our suave hero.
The film's storyline revolves around Helm's battle against his very organization-gone-rogue, known as ICE. With an impending threat of global catastrophe fueled by a dangerous weapon, the film takes the audience into a churning vortex of action-filled sequences and suspense. The narrative involves Helm attempting to thwart this catastrophe, reintegrating himself into the world he thought he had left behind.
The backdrop is the Cold War era, replete with its tensions and anxieties, omnipresent throughout the film through a series of daring adventures and chilling showdowns. The plot cleverly leverages this background to capture the essence of mid-60s spy thrillers: dangerous foes, beautiful women, high-stake missions, and the unrelenting pursuit of peace.

The movie was a commercial success and initiated a series of subsequent films starring Martin as Matt Helm. It managed to retain its charm over the years through its unique take on the genre: a reluctant hero, action-packed sequences, a global catastrophe, and an ample share of humor and wit.

The Silencers is a Comedy, Action, Adventure movie released in 1966. It has a runtime of 102 min Critics and viewers have rated it moderate reviews, with an IMDb score of 5.9..
